Learn to Swim Assistant Teacher – Aquababies & Early Years Teacher Pathway
Dive In Swimming Academy – Jamisontown NSW
Dive In Swimming Academy | Jamisontown | Casual | Weekday morning, afternoons and weekend shifts available
Bring your experience with children into a rewarding teaching career!
Dive In Swimming Academy is looking for a patient, dependable and experienced person to join our Aquababies and Early Years - Future Learn To Swim Teacher Pathway.
This role is ideal for someone with at least five years’ experience working with babies, young children or families who would like to develop into a qualified Learn to Swim Teacher.
Previous swim-school experience is not required. We are looking for someone who can build trust with children, communicate confidently with parents and create warm, positive experiences in the water.
You will begin by assisting qualified teachers while completing Dive In’s practical mentoring pathway. You will also be expected to complete the external Royal Life Saving Swim Teacher course and progress towards teaching your own classes within an appropriate timeframe.
This is a teacher development position, not an ongoing assistant-only role.
